What is a weekend product development chef?

Weekend Product Development Chefs are culinary professionals who focus on creating and testing new food products, recipes, or menu items, typically during weekends. They work in food companies, restaurants, or test kitchens, collaborating with other chefs, food scientists, and marketing teams to develop innovative dishes that meet consumer trends and business needs. Their responsibilities often include experimenting with ingredients, refining recipes, ensuring food safety, and sometimes presenting new products to stakeholders. Weekend schedules allow for flexibility and may cater to product launches, special events, or peak operational times.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a weekend product development chef,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Weekend Product Development Chef, you need culinary expertise, creativity in recipe formulation, and a background in food science or culinary arts, often supported by relevant certifications. Familiarity with kitchen equipment, food safety regulations, and product development software is typically required. Strong organizational skills, teamwork, and effective communication make someone stand out in this role. These skills are essential for creating innovative, high-quality food products that meet market demands and safety standards, especially under time constraints.

What are some common challenges faced by weekend product development chefs, and how can they be addressed?

Weekend Product Development Chefs often face the challenge of limited time to test and iterate new recipes, as well as coordinating with team members who may work standard weekday shifts. To address these challenges, it's important to plan experiments in advance, maintain clear communication with the broader product development team, and document findings thoroughly for follow-up during the week. Flexibility and strong organizational skills can help ensure that project milestones are met despite the condensed schedule.

What is the difference between Weekend Product Development Chef vs Weekend Pastry Chef?

AspectWeekend Product Development ChefWeekend Pastry Chef
CredentialsCulinary degree, product development experienceCulinary degree, pastry specialization
Work EnvironmentTest kitchens, R&D labs, food companiesBakery, restaurant pastry sections
Industry UsageFood manufacturing, product innovationHotels, bakeries, restaurants

The Weekend Product Development Chef focuses on creating new food products and recipes, often working in test kitchens or food companies. In contrast, the Weekend Pastry Chef specializes in preparing baked goods and desserts, typically in bakeries or restaurant settings. Both roles require culinary skills and experience, but their primary focus and work environments differ.

Pepsi Lipton is a unique joint venture between Unilever and PepsiCo, combining over 125 years of tea expertise to pioneer the global ready-to-drink tea category. As an autonomous global business, we develop and launch products worldwide, offering broad exposure and opportunities to shape the future of beverages.

Our teams are passionate about unlocking the power of tea and pushing the boundaries of innovation from science to sensory to deliver exciting, high-quality products that reach millions of consumers globally.

We are seeking a highly motivated Product Development Scientist to join our R&D team in Valhalla, in a unique dual-impact role that combines Technical Brand Stewardship for LATAM markets with Innovation developments for Global programs.

This is a pivotal role for a technically strong and creative product developer who will drive end-to-end product development on global programs and build technical depth and capabilities in future-facing beverage platforms, while serving as a key technical partner for LATAM business continuity projects.

This role combines hands-on development expertise with the ability to build and strengthen technical capabilities across key strategic areas. You will be part of the Global cross-functional Inno-Hub team, driving breakthrough innovation for two of our key brands (Lipton and Pure Leaf), while also contributing to the Global R&D capability agenda, developing technical solutions to current and future product design challenges.

The successful candidate will leverage strong product development, formulation, and problem-solving skills to ensure existing LATAM portfolio remain compliant, high quality, and fit-for-purpose, while helping to deliver future-focused innovation across global programs. The position requires a technically curious, consumer-focused scientist who thrives in a fast-paced environment and can effectively balance stewardship priorities with innovation-driven product development.

Responsibilities
  • Lead and deliver end-to-end product development for global innovation programs, from concept through to commercialization.
  • Own formulation design and technical problem-solving, translating briefs into robust, scalable product solutions.
  • Build and apply technical expertise in key areas: milk tea, functional ingredients, and fresh brew tea processing.
  • Design and execute experimental programs, including lab development, product testing, and shelf-life validation.
  • Lead product scale-up, supporting pilot and factory trials to ensure successful implementation.
  • Drive creativity and consumer-centric design, leveraging external inspiration (e.g. chefs, mixologists).
  • Contribute to global capability building, sharing learnings and strengthening best practices across teams.
  • Ensure strong technical documentation and knowledge capture to support global delivery and future reuse.
  • Design and execute experiments to investigate, troubleshoot, and resolve product and process issues through sound scientific analysis and technical recommendations.
  • Lead product reformulations required to maintain regulatory compliance, ingredient transitions, supply continuity, and quality expectations.
  • Validate ingredients, raw materials, and product changes to ensure fitness for purpose and successful market implementation.
  • Partner with cross-functional areas like Regulatory, Analytical, Micro, Supply Chain, Marketing, Sensory, etc. to deliver robust, safe, legal, stable and fit for consumer products.
  • Engage and manage external partners and suppliers, clearly defining technical requirements and driving innovation.
  • Partner internally with Global Science Platform and externally with key strategic vendors to source ingredients and leverage expertise in ingredient functionality.
